Brendon O'Connor admitted he will "miss" the opportunity to play rugby at Welford Road when the New Zealander spoke to LTTV on the pitch following his final appearance for the club in the Round 22 fixture against Bath Rugby.

O'Connor made his debut for Leicester Tigers in 2015 and went on to make 73 appearances, including 60 in the starting side, over four seasons.

"It was always a treat to play here ... I'm going to miss it," O'Connor said.

The Kiwi flanker signed off in the same style that he began his Tigers career, when he crossed for a try on debut against Stade Francais and a try in last weekend's Premiership fixture against Leicester's long-time rival - his 11th for the club, taking his points contribution to more than 50 from the back-row.

O'Connor departs a fan favourite after an impressive showing throughout his four seasons with the club and one of 18 senior squad members to say farewell this summer ahead of the 2019/20 season.

His fellow countryman and flanker Jordan Taufua will make the move to the East Midlands following the 2019 Rugby World Cup in Japan to join the likes of Guy Thompson, Tommy Reffell, Sione Kalamafoni, Dave Denton and Sam Lewis as options for Tigers head coach Geordan Murphy to choose from in the back-row next season.
